接下来小编给大家简单介绍一下免费mysql数据库,希望能帮助到您,更多相关请关注本网站。
1. 什么是MySQL数据库?
MySQL数据库是一种流行的开源数据库管理系统(DBMS),它是由瑞典公司MySQL AB开发的,并于2008年被甲骨文公司收购。MySQL数据库可以使用在许多不同的应用程序中,例如WordPress、Drupal、Magento等基于Web的应用程序,还可以用于开发各种软件解决方案。MySQL数据库支持多种操作系统平台,包括Windows、Linux、Unix等,它也支持多种编程语言,如Java、Python、PHP等。
2. MySQL数据库的优缺点
优点:
(1) 开源软件,下载、安装、使用都是免费的。
(2) 能够运行在多种操作系统上,包括Windows、Linux、Unix等。
(3) 支持多种编程语言,包括Java、Python、PHP等。
(4) 具有极高的性能和可扩展性,支持负载均衡和分布式架构。
(5) MySQL数据库的安全性非常高,能够支持完善的系统访问控制。
缺点:
(1) MySQL数据库只能支持比较小的数据量,处理大量数据时会变得较慢。
(2) 安全性虽然高,但数据完整性方面不如Oracle等商业数据库。
(3) 不支持ACID(原子性、一致性、隔离性、持久性)事务。
3. 免费MySQL数据库的常见应用场景
(1) 建立关系型数据库:MySQL数据库是自由软件,因此在多种场它下都得到了广泛的应用,包括企业、机构、学术界等。
(2) 网络应用程序:MySQL数据库是处理互联网数据的一个理想工具,可以帮助建立和管理基于Web的应用程序,例如在线商店、论坛和博客等。
(3) 大数据分析:MySQL数据库支持分析工具,这使得大数据分析成为一项可以简便地完成的任务。
(4) 云服务:很多云计算服务商都支持MySQL数据库,如亚马逊云、微软云Azure等。
4. 免费MySQL数据库的下载与安装
(1) 下载MySQL数据库
MySQL数据库的下载地址为:https://dev.mysql.com/downloads/mysql/
用户可以根据自己的操作系统选择相应版本的MySQL数据库下载。
(2) 安装MySQL数据库
安装MySQL数据库时,需要注意以下几点:
a. 双击下载后的.msi文件,会出现提示框,点击“Run”按钮,进入下一步。
b. 在弹出的安装向导中,注意MySQL数据库的安装目录,以及数据存储的位置等信息。
c. 在设置密码时,需要设置一个强密码,以保护数据的安全。
d. 安装完成后,需要在MySQL数据库的命令行界面中,使用root账户登录,完成MySQL数据库的基本配置。
5. 免费MySQL数据库的基本操作
(1) 启动/关闭MySQL数据库:
在Windows平台上,MySQL数据库的启动可以通过“服务”控制台完成,在Linux平台上可以使用命令行操作。
例如,在Windows平台上,启动MySQL数据库可以使用以下命令:
net start mysql
关闭MySQL数据库可以使用以下命令:
net stop mysql
(2) 登录MySQL数据库:
在连接MySQL数据库时,需要输入所连接的主机地址、用户名和密码等信息。常用的连接命令如下:
mysql -h 主机地址 -u 用户名 -p
(3) 创建与管理数据库:
创建新的数据库,可以使用以下命令:
CREATE DATABASE 数据库名
删除数据库,可以使用以下命令:
DROP DATABASE 数据库名
(4) 创建与管理数据表:
创建新的数据表,可以使用以下命令:
CREATE TABLE 表名(
字段名 类型,
字段名 类型,
……
)
删除数据表,可以使用以下命令:
DROP TABLE 表名
(5) 插入和查询数据:
插入数据,可以使用以下命令:
INSERT INTO 表名(字段名1,字段名2,…)VALUES(值1,值2,…);
查询数据,可以使用以下命令:
SELECT * FROM 表名 WHERE 条件;
(6) 更新和删除数据:
更新数据,可以使用以下命令:
UPDATE 表名 SET 字段1=值1,字段2=值2,…WHERE 条件;
删除数据,可以使用以下命令:
DELETE FROM 表名 WHERE 条件;
6. 小结
MySQL数据库是流行的开源数据库,其免费使用、高性能和可扩展性得到了广泛的应用。MySQL数据库在多种应用场景下都具有很大的用途,例如建立关系型数据库,网站应用程序,大数据分析和云服务等。用户可以通过下载、安装和配置MySQL数据库,进行创建和管理数据库、数据表以及插入、查询、更新和删除数据等基本操作。MySQL数据库也有一些缺点,例如只能支持较小的数据量、较差的数据完整性等。
1. 背景
MySQL是一种广泛使用的开源数据库管理系统,因其免费,易于使用和广泛支持而受到了许多人的欢迎。随着时间的推移,MySQL的不同版本不断更新和发布,因此,很多人可能会感到困惑,MySQL的哪个版本是免费的。本文将详细介绍MySQL的各个版本以及它们的费用。
2. MySQL的不同版本
MySQL分为多个版本,具体如下:
1)MySQL Enterprise Edition
MySQL企业版是针对商业客户的高级版本,包含丰富的高级功能和支持服务。它提供了一系列的高级工具,用于安全,可扩展性,高可用性等。它具有许多特性,例如:
a) 自动故障转移
b) 支持最新的硬件设备
c) 高级监视和管理工具
d) 增强的存储引擎
e) 安全性特性
f) 专业的技术支持
MySQL企业版提供了许多功能,但它需要购买授权才能使用。
2)MySQL Standard Edition
MySQL标准版是适用于中小企业和开发人员的版本,它包含了MySQL的核心函数和提供了一些高级功能的基本工具。它支持多种平台,可以是Linux、Windows、Unix等等。MySQL标准版涵盖了很多基本功能,例如:
a) 支持InnoDB和MyISAM存储引擎
b) 统计分析
c) 安全性特性
d) 最大连接数500
e) 支持集群配置
MySQL标准版也需要购买授权才能使用。
3)MySQL Community Edition
MySQL社区版是免费的开源版本,针对开发人员和个人使用者。它包含了一些基本功能和工具,如:
a) 数据库安装
b) 数据库管理工具
c) 统计查询
d) 权限管理
e) 备份和恢复
f) PHP、Perl、Python等工具和API
MySQL社区版可以免费下载和使用。
3. MySQL哪个版本免费?
如上所述,MySQL企业版和标准版都需要购买授权才能使用,而MySQL社区版是免费的开源版本,可以免费下载和使用。此外,MySQL集群版和其他辅助工具也有免费版本。可以在MySQL官方网站上找到相关信息。
4. 总结
本文详细介绍了MySQL的不同版本,包括MySQL企业版,MySQL标准版和MySQL社区版。MySQL企业版和MySQL标准版都需要购买授权才能使用,而MySQL社区版是开源免费的,可以免费下载和使用。了解这些版本的区别和限制非常重要,可以帮助开发人员、公司和个人选择适合自己的MySQL版本,并根据需求升级。
总之,如果您只是为了简单地存储和查询数据,那么MySQL社区版是您的首选。但如果您需要更高级和专业的功能和工具,那么MySQL企业版和标准版是值得考虑的选择。
综上所述,上面我们介绍了这么多免费mysql数据库,字数约7476字,不知道你们了解了没有,如果还没有了解,可以关注本网站会为您提供优质的文章。